Webone to four clock cycles of latency. When creating large RAM arrays from cascaded UltraRAMs, latency is a function of the number of UltraRAMs used—i.e., the size of the array and the target operating frequency. Power Reduction UltraRAM offers various built-in features to maximize power efficiency, often without user intervention. The PL-BRAM does not exhibit any latency difference between serialized versus random ac-cess. BRAM accesses latency is independent of access pattern as it lacks constructs like banks and row buffers that are common in DRAMs. We also ran the latency benchmark with caching enabled for varying working set sizes.

WebBRAMs are synchronous in all FPGA families that I've used. Xilinx recommend that you also use the optional output register to improve timing (for non-trivial clock frequencies). This will result in a two clock read delay. You'll have to deal with this delay in your design.
